A PoE switch can transmit both data and power over a single Ethernet cable, while a regular switch only handles data, requiring separate power sources for connected devices.

Key Differences

  • Power Delivery: PoE switches supply electrical power to devices like IP cameras, VoIP phones, and wireless access points through the Ethernet cable, eliminating the need for separate power adapters. Regular switches do not provide power, so each device must have its own power source .
  • Deployment Flexibility: PoE switches simplify installation in locations where power outlets are limited or hard to access, such as ceilings, walls, or outdoor areas. Regular switches require additional wiring for power, making deployment more complex .
  • Device Compatibility: PoE switches can support both PoE-enabled and non-PoE devices, allowing mixed networks. Regular switches can only handle non-PoE devices unless a PoE injector is added to supply power .
  • Network Management: Many PoE switches offer centralized power management, enabling remote rebooting or monitoring of connected devices. Regular switches typically lack this feature .

Advantages of PoE in Branch Offices

  • Simplified Wiring: One cable provides both data and power, reducing clutter and installation costs .
  • Scalability: PoE switches allow easy expansion of network devices without worrying about additional power outlets .
  • Support for Remote Work: Branch offices in Norway or elsewhere can efficiently connect devices like Wi-Fi 6/7 access points, IP cameras, and VoIP phones to the corporate network, ensuring stable connectivity for remote employees .

When a Regular Switch is Sufficient

  • If all connected devices have their own power sources and PoE is not required, a regular switch is more cost-effective and simpler to deploy .
  • For small offices or environments where power management and flexible device placement are not critical, a standard switch can meet network needs without extra complexity .

Practical Considerations

  • PoE Budget: Ensure the PoE switch can supply enough power per port for all connected devices.
  • Cable Lengths: Ethernet cables have a maximum effective length (typically 100 meters) for both data and power transmission.
  • Hybrid Networks: Some networks combine PoE and regular switches to optimize cost and functionality, using PoE switches for powered devices and regular switches for standard computers or printers . In summary, for a Norwegian branch office, a PoE switch is ideal when devices require power over Ethernet, flexible placement, or centralized management, while a regular switch is sufficient for standard network connections without power needs.
